The value of $$\frac{{\sin A}}{{\cot A + {\text{cosec}}\,A}} - \frac{{\sin A}}{{\cot A - {\text{cosec}}\,A}} - 1{\text{ is:}}$$

A. $$\frac{1}{2}$$

B. 3

C. 0

D. 2

Answer: Option B

Solution(By Examveda Team)

$$\eqalign{ & \frac{{\sin A}}{{\cot A + {\text{cosec}}\,A}} - \frac{{\sin A}}{{\cot A - {\text{cosec}}\,A}} - 1 \cr & = \sin A\left[ {\frac{{\cot A - {\text{cosec}}\,A - \cot A - {\text{cosec}}\,A}}{{{{\cot }^2}A - {\text{cose}}{{\text{c}}^2}A}}} \right] - 1 \cr & = \frac{{ - 2\sin A.{\text{cosec}}\,A}}{{ - 1}} + 1 \cr & = 2 + 1 \cr & = 3 \cr} $$
